Excerpt from: Letter From United Mine Workers I do not know what type heating equipment the President Intends to use in the house in question, but I do know the Republican leadership is circulating a story that he will use oil. This rumor is hurting the cause of the Democratic Party and its candidates in the vast anthracite region in northeastern Pennsylvania.... | ![]() Read Full Text |
